Sean Rhyan

On September 15, 2000, Sean Michael Rhyan, a guard with the Green Bay Packers of the National Football League, was born.

When Rhyan was younger, he primarily played baseball and rugby. He was reared in Ladera Ranch, California, after being born in Laguna Hills, California.

He began his education at Capistrano Valley Christian School in San Juan Capistrano, California, and after his first year transferred to San Juan Hills High School.

Rhyan competed in the 2019 All-American Bowl as a senior and was recognized as the male athlete of the year by the Orange County Register. Rhyan also captured the Division 1 CIF Southern Section title in the shot put.

Where did Sean Rhyan go to college?

Sean Rhyan went to UCLA

Did Sean Rhyan play college football?

Yes, prior to the start of his first season, Rhyan was designated the Bruins’ offensive tackle starter. He started each of UCLA’s 12 games, and both USA Today and the Football Writers Association of America named him a Freshman All-American. In the Bruins’ seven games during the COVID-19-shortened 2020 season, Rhyan started each one.
